Dorothy Parkes Community Centre is pleased to announce an upcoming Community Litter Pick and Greenpeace Eco Event, taking place on Saturday 16th May 2026. Delivered in partnership with Greenpeace Birmingham, the event is designed to bring local residents together for a morning of environmental action, learning, and community connection.

This free event reflects the Centre’s ongoing commitment to supporting sustainable initiatives and encouraging community-led action to care for local spaces.

A Morning of Action and Learning

The day will begin at 10:00am, with participants gathering at the Dorothy Parkes Centre before heading out for a coordinated litter pick. Volunteers will help clean the grounds of Smethwick Old Church and surrounding roads, contributing directly to improving the local environment.

Following the litter pick, attendees will return to the Centre for a welcome presentation from Greenpeace at 11:30am. This session will offer insight into current environmental challenges, along with practical steps individuals and communities can take to reduce their impact.

The event will conclude with a relaxed tea and homemade cakes session at 12:00pm, providing an opportunity for informal discussion, information sharing, and community networking.
